The Core Formula
The present value of an annuity formula determines the periodic payment based on a lump sum:
$$PMT = PV \times \frac{r(1+r)^n}{(1+r)^n - 1}$$
Where:
- PMT = Periodic payment amount
- PV = Present value (your principal/lump sum)
- r = Interest rate per period
- n = Total number of payment periods

Total Payout Comparison
| Duration | Monthly Payment | Total Payout | Interest Earned |
| 5 years | $9,208 | $552,479 | $52,479 |
| 10 years | $5,062 | $607,396 | $107,396 |
| 20 years | $3,030 | $727,180 | $227,180 |
| 30 years | $2,387 | $859,363 | $359,363 |
